dc.description.abstract Prohibits hunting and the cutting down of trees in the King's forests. At end of text: "Given under my hand, and the seal of my office, this 19th day of August [in the] ninth year of the reign of our sovereign Lord William the third, by the grace of God, of England, Scotland, France and Ireland, [De]fender of the Faith, &c. Annoq; Dom. 1697." Reproduction of original in the British Library.
